Adapted Top
The top that i adapted is the grey one on top. Firstly i cut the sleeves off then tied them back together again. As you can see at the bottom . Then i cut the bottom of the top off to make the ruff at the top. I made the ruff by cutting slits and sort of looping them together. These are all techniques i learnt in textiles and i loooooove them.

Mary Katrantzou
I love ehr collection , ecspecially the lampshade skirts , which are no ordinary lampshade skirts they are actual lampshades with fringing and and antique paterns , if i could afford one i would buy it without a doubt and where it everyday till it breaks then i would use for my lampshade , the only thing about wearing it would be the sitting down which would be tricky ecspecially on the bus .... hmmmmm ahwell no pain no gain and anyway its not like its actually going to happen......... I also loved the opening dress with the house on it was so lovley and if you ever went away and felt homesick im sure wearing it would help you to feel alot better , oh my days she should sell pesonalised dresses with your own house on , not that i would buy no matter how much it was ..... ( well) ... i also loved the quirky wedges , the peeptoes with a strap but im not sure which colour i prefered , the pink and grey ones reminded me of that strawberry chcolate you get from thorntons yum . So actually id have to say that the pink and grey were my favorite but purley on the choclate fact.
